The FLICC Institute for Federal Library Technicians--Monday, July 26
through Friday, July 30, 2004
See a draft of the agenda below as well as other important
information.
Designed for both the newer and the seasoned library technician, this
week-long institute will provide a broad overview of federal library
work. The program will open with a dynamic keynote presentation on
professionalism and the federal library technician and will continue
with presentations by noted experts and panel discussions by federal
library staff members. The week will also include subject-oriented
tours
of selected areas of the Library of Congress and moderated breakout
sessions for participants to interact with their peers. (Note: This
program replicates the Technicians Institutes held in 1997-2003.)

Draft of Agenda
Monday, July 26
AM
* Welcome and Introduction
-- Keynote: Sybil Bullock, Retired Director, Redstone Scientific
Information Center, Adjunct Professor, School of Library and
Information
Science, University of Alabama
* Technicians Panel
PM
* History of Books and Libraries
* Breakout Sessions on: Circulation, Interlibrary Loan, Cataloging,
Acquisitions, and Reference
Tuesday, July 27
AM
* Government Funding
* Acquisitions/ Collection Development
* Serials
PM
* Preservation
* Cataloging Concepts
Wednesday, July 28
AM
* Integrated Library Services (ILS)
* Online Services
* The World Wide Web
PM
* Library of Congress Tours to: Cataloging, Congressional Research
Service, Copyright, Law Library, Science and Technology, Serial and
Government Publications, Geography and Map, and the Main Reading Room
Thursday, July 29
AM
* Reference Process/Reference Sources
PM
* Government Documents
* Virtual Reference
* Print to Pixels: Digitizing
Friday, July 30
AM
* Customer Services
PM
* Personnel Issues and Career Development
* Professional Associations Panel
-- ALA, DCLA, SLA, VLA
* Certificates/Conclusion
